The utility allows you to download firmware into and upload firmware from
the memory of a Cypress EZ-USB/FX2/FX3 chips. It is a de facto standard
for programming this family of devices.
This port is based on original fxload(8) program available from Linux
Hotplug Project. Libusb support has been provided to correctly work on
FreeBSD and patches for the FX3 have been merged in.
gtkfind is the program to use when you don't want to have to remember all
the options to find(1). It is a graphical program that allows you to
search for files and (optionally) perform operations on them. You can
search for files by using wildcards, by matching file types and/or
permissions, etc. gtkfind requires X and the GTK+ toolkit. It is still
under development, but has reached a stage where it is actually useful.
Ddate prints the date in Discordian date format.
If called with no arguments, ddate will get the current system date, convert
this to the Discordian date format and print this on the standard output.
Alternatively, a Gregorian date may be specified on the command line, in the
form of a numerical day, month and year.

Lazyread is a C program that auto-scrolls files on your screen
in movie credit fashion. It allows the user to read without having
to manually scroll down to see new pages. There are lots of
features, such as being able to choose the speed at which it
scrolls, pause, dynamic speed up, the ability to highlight lines
that contain a specified string, and much more.

Acme::ButFirst allows you to execute a block of code, but first do
something else. Perfect for when you wish to add to the start of a long
block of code, but don't have the energy to scroll upwards in your editor.
Acme::ButFirst recognises both butfirst and but first as keywords.
Usage of Acme::ButFirst is lexically scoped. ButFirstification can be
explicitly disabled by using no Acme::ButFirst.
YABT means Yet another Braille Translator.
YABT is a general purpose Braille translation system
written in pure python. It is primarily designed to
be used by the BrlTex Project, but due to its general
design it may be suited to use in other projects.
Currently YABT has a table for translation in to British
Braille encoded in ASCII Braille, but tables for other
codes and other output encodings such as unicode Braille
are possible.
Camserv is a free program to do streaming video through the web
Streaming video can be sent to both Netscape and Internet Explorer clients.
However, Internet Explorer under Windows cannot apparently handle
the multi-part JPEGs, and therefore a special javascript page must be setup.
One is included in the distribution as an example.
Currently, the only supported BSD device is the bktr driver.
Both tunable modes and camera inputs are supported.
Fxtv is an X11-based FreeBSD app that provides TV-in-a-window and
image/audio/video capture capabilities for Brooktree Bt848/849/878/879
and Pinnacle PCTV tuner/capture cards.
To use this app, you need a capture card supported by the bktr(4) driver.
Examples include the Hauppauge Wincast/TV, the STB TV PCI, and the Intel
Smart Video Recorder III. See the 'bktr' man page for more information.

this is a small channel scan tool for vdr which generates ATSC, DVB-C,
DVB-S/S2 and DVB-T channels.conf files.
It's 50% "scan" from linuxtv-dvb-apps-1.1.0, the differences are:
- no initial tuning data needed, because scanning without this data is exactly
what a scan tool like this should do
- it detects automatically which DVB/ATSC card to use.
libfame is a video encoding library.
It can currently encode MPEG-1 and MPEG-4 rectangular video, as well as
MPEG-4 video with arbitrary shape.
Objectives
- Compliance : Provide bitstreams compliant to the MPEG-1, MPEG-2 and
MPEG-4 video standards.
- Speed : Provide a fast implementation of the techniques used in MPEG
standards.
- Flexibility : Allow the user to choose between different options for
speed, compression ratio and quality.
- Portability : Support many different platforms and architectures.
